The Validator Node Selection Process, within cryptocurrency, options trading, and financial derivatives, represents a critical mechanism ensuring network security and operational integrity. It dictates how nodes responsible for validating transactions and maintaining the blockchain’s state are chosen, impacting consensus mechanisms and overall system resilience. This selection isn’t solely about computational power; it increasingly incorporates factors like reputation, stake size, and adherence to governance protocols, particularly within decentralized autonomous organizations (DAOs). Sophisticated algorithms and economic incentives are employed to discourage malicious behavior and promote a diverse, reliable validator set, directly influencing the security and efficiency of the underlying system.
